Police Log: Injury From Car Accident, Restraining Order
The following information was supplied by the Holliston police department. Where arrests or charges are mentioned, it does not indicate a conviction.
Monday, June 4
8:52 a.m.: A Birch Road resident reported her elderly husband was missing, possibly en route to coffee haven. Holliston police officers responded to locate the man and return him to his residence.
7:46 a.m.: A resident called in regarding a theft from her home. Information was passed to a detective.
10:10 a.m.: Multiple callers reported a car crash with injuries at the intersection of Washington Street and Locust Street. An ambulance responded to assist the injured. Two vehicles were towed and two occupants were transported to hospital for evaluation.
1:29 p.m.: A Cheryl Lane caller reported a verbal domestic dispute between a husband and his wife. Officers transported the female to Framingham court so she could apply for a restraining order.
3:11 p.m.: A Marked Tree Road resident reported smoke coming from the energy lines nearby. The Holliston Fire Department responded.
